Problems solved by technology

[0003] However, when the yaw brake of the existing wind power generator brakes, due to the inertia of the nose rotation during the braking process, there is a deviation in the position of the nose when braking towards the direction of the incoming wind until the end of the braking. Therefore, the yaw accuracy of the wind turbine head is low, which affects the power generation efficiency. After the yaw brake of the existing wind turbine directly brakes the upper installation ring plate, the yaw motor drive shaft stops rotating. When the inertia is braked, the instantaneous resistance is relatively large, and it is easy to damage

Abstract

The invention relates to the field of wind power generation equipment, and discloses a yaw brake of a wind power generator, comprising a lower mounting ring plate, a limiting bearing, and an upper mounting ring plate, the lower mounting ring plate and the upper mounting ring plate being respectively connected with the bottom ring of the limiting bearing It is fixedly connected with the top ring, the top of the upper installation ring plate is fixedly connected with the head of the wind turbine, and the bottom of the lower installation ring plate is fixedly connected with the frame of the wind turbine. The positioning wheel is set on the upper bearing of the linkage shaft that drives the overall rotation of the upper installation ring plate, and the return spring is connected between the rotating ring plate and the positioning wheel that rotates at the bottom of the lower installation ring plate. The rotation of the upper installation ring plate is braked, and the distance that the rotating ring plate continues to rotate under the action of inertial force during the braking process is used to compensate the distance value of the rotating ring plate behind the positioning wheel, which improves the control of wind turbine head deflection. flight accuracy.

Description

technical field [0001] The invention relates to the field of wind power generation equipment, in particular to a yaw brake of a wind power generator. Background technique [0002] Wind energy generator is a device that converts wind energy into kinetic energy. It uses wind energy for clean and pollution-free power generation. With the promotion of environmental protection, there are more and more applications. In order to improve the power generation efficiency of wind turbines, it is necessary to set up a yaw system to control the head of the machine. The yaw brake is a device that brakes when the nose yaw rotates to the incoming wind direction, so as to ensure that the nose is facing the incoming direction.
